"A Third of the Trains Didn't Even Make It to Nymburk During the shift." the Double Closures of the Railway Administration Also Worried šKoda Auto

It's a paradox: the Czech Republic has the densest railway network in the European Union, but freight transport still has problems serving its key customers. The reason: frequent and sometimes not fully coordinated closures. This is shown in September by the case of one of its key customers, the car manufacturer Škoda Auto.
